Star Baik Restaurant

Salah Al Din St - Deira - Dubai - United Arab Emirates
Service Options Dine-in Takeaway No-contact delivery
About

Star Baik Restaurant is a restaurant located in Dubai, United Arab Emirates. The average rating of this business is 3.50 out of 5 stars based on 31 reviews. The street address of this business is Salah Al Din St - Deira - Dubai - United Arab Emirates. Star Baik Restaurant is open seven days a week 24 hours a day.

FAQs
Where Star Baik Restaurant is located at?
Star Baik Restaurant is located at Salah Al Din St - Deira - Dubai - United Arab Emirates.
What is the contact number of Star Baik Restaurant?
The contact number of Star Baik Restaurant is +971 4 882 8587
Map Location
Business Hours
Thursday 24hr open
Friday 24hr open
Saturday 24hr open
Sunday 24hr open
Monday 24hr open
Tuesday 24hr open
Wednesday 24hr open
Nearby Businesses

Al Bayan Supermarket

Al Bayan Supermarket

78C9+3W3 - Salah Al Din St - Deira - Dubai - United Arab Emirates

AIM REALTY INTERNATIONAL

AIM REALTY INTERNATIONAL

Dar Al Aman Bldg - 12 Salah Al Din St - beside Al Bayan Supermarket - Deira - Dubai - United Arab Emirates

Grand outlet salah din

Grand outlet salah din

Deira - Dubai - United Arab Emirates

Al Naghama Grocery

Al Naghama Grocery

Salah Al Din St - Deira - Dubai - United Arab Emirates

Panadero Pastry Shop (Salah Al Din)

Panadero Pastry Shop (Salah Al Din)

Salah Al Din St - Deira - Dubai - United Arab Emirates

AL NAGHMA GROCERY (L.L.C)

AL NAGHMA GROCERY (L.L.C)

Fish Roundabout - Salahuddin St - Deira - Dubai - United Arab Emirates

Al Ahli Travel & Tourist Agency

Al Ahli Travel & Tourist Agency

Salah Al Din St - Deira - Dubai - United Arab Emirates

Salah Al Din Metro Station 1

Salah Al Din Metro Station 1

Deira - Dubai - United Arab Emirates

Art Abaya

Art Abaya

Al - Naif St - Deira - Dubai - United Arab Emirates

Shabab Al freej car paking

Shabab Al freej car paking

12a Street - Deira - Dubai - United Arab Emirates

Muhammad Shahbaz Maqbool

Muhammad Shahbaz Maqbool

Salah Al Din St - Deira - Dubai - United Arab Emirates

ALZIKRA OPTICALS BRANCH

ALZIKRA OPTICALS BRANCH

S 64-3 Dar Al-Aman Building 12 Near Salahuddin Metro Station - Al Muraqqabat - Dubai - United Arab Emirates